Action item from the Marrowgate outage: all plugins calling the Tindervale charge endpoint must attach an idempotency key to every retry, derived from the original attempt rather than regenerated. The gateway now rejects keyless retries after the grace window. Retry pacing should match the platform defaults, which are set out below for reference.

tuning table, hafog-bahaf:
QUOTAS = {
    "praion": 144,
    "briax": 906,
    "silwyn": 451,
}

## Capacity note: alert deduplicator

Plugin authors: the Hollis dedup stage hashes your alert fingerprint and holds it in a bounded ring per tenant. Emit stable fingerprints or you burn ring slots and dedup stops working. Plugins exceeding the per-tenant publish rate get throttled, not queued. Budget memory at roughly one slot per open incident, times your fan-out. Do not assume the defaults; operators override them. Current defaults ship as the constants below.

limits module of fajog-tawig:
RATE_LIMITS = {
    "druwyn": 2,
    "quenael": 10,
    "wenix": 2,
    "druael": 2,
}

Subject: Hotfix out for the session-token refresh bug

Hi all — quick heads-up for reviewers. The Wardenly gateway was refreshing session tokens one tick too late, so users on slow links occasionally got bounced to login mid-request. The fix moves the refresh check ahead of the proxy handoff and adds a small grace window. Please eyeball the retry logic in the refresh handler; that's where I'm least confident. Hotfix is staged on the canary ring now. For verification, match your canary against the build token below.

pipeline stamp: htk9_ce63042d9